I am a new pilot and I fly in New England. What is the deal with Gastons? I see all the posts about it and it sounds like everyone goes there all the time.
 
gmwalk said:
I don't understand this Gastons stuff. I never heard of it before I started reading this board (and the red board.)

I am a new pilot and I fly in New England. What is the deal with Gastons? I see all the posts about it and it sounds like everyone goes there all the time.
It's a fly-in launched a couple of years ago primarily as a way for webboarders to meet each other. (Diana Richards is social coordinator.) We just pick a weekend in the summer and go to Gastons, which is a resort in northern Arkansas with its own grass strip. For more, visit www.gastonsflyin.com.
 
Few years ago folks were chatting on the board about linking up somewhere in the mid south. Lots of suggestions about different places.

I had recently visited Gaston's with my nieces and had a video of flying in. Chip posted it on his site. Lots of folks looked at it and thought it was pretty neat! Still, a lot of other places were discussed, but after some back and forth, several folks just decided to fly in there one weekend--Diana was definitely an instigator!! Many others joined in and we all just kind of flew up there. Diana and Tom were there, Bill S, Dr. Bruce, Lance and lots of other folks. I flew in with a dad, son and friend. Many of us really enjoyed the informal area, meeting other board members we had chatted with many times and seeing each other's planes and chatting 'bout them.

Some of us have done several other things together since this and become good friends! It's not a sponsored, ad driven, event. Just some of us that really have a lot in common meeting. Lots of different skill levels; different planes; interesting folks.

Since I first went, the dad that first went with me passed, and it's become a nastolgic event for some of us to remember how much he enjoyed the trip and the place.
